Recently, there has been a rejuvenation of interest in various types of traditional Irish clothing. One of the reasons these have become so popular again is because of their durability and comfort. Irish clothes are among some of the most durable clothes in the world because the climate in Ireland is quite rainy and cool. Therefore, they tend to use a lot of wool because it deflects a lot of moisture, but retains heat. When it comes to arans and sweaters, this is exactly what most people will ask for. However, wool clothing is hard to come by if you are not in Ireland stocking up.
